10Google Services

If you connect Google services (such as Google Analytics, Google Search Console, Google Business Profile, or YouTube), you authorize Eliora OS to access the data covered by the scopes you approve through Google’s OAuth consent process, and only for the user-facing features described in our Privacy Policy. Eliora OS’s use and transfer of information received from Google APIs will adhere to the Google API Services User Data Policy, including the Limited Use requirements. You can revoke Eliora OS’s access at any time through your Google Account permissions. Your use of Google services remains subject to Google’s terms.

11AI-Assisted Features

The Services include AI-assisted features that generate analysis, content, recommendations, summaries, and similar outputs based on information you provide or authorize. AI-assisted processing may involve third-party AI providers acting as our service providers.

AI outputs may contain errors. AI-generated outputs may be inaccurate, incomplete, or unsuitable for your purpose, and do not constitute professional, legal, financial, tax, or marketing advice. You are solely responsible for reviewing, verifying, and editing AI-assisted outputs before relying on them, sharing them with clients, or publishing them. Eliora OS does not warrant the accuracy or fitness of AI-assisted outputs.
